About the Item
California visual artist Kim Frohsin is unsurpassed in her depictions of figures, mostly female, usually in paintings that are intimate in size and scale. All of her work, whether representational or figurative, results from her interactions with and observations of her live models during collaborative drawing sessions.
The artist fluently wields a visual language of her own creation, and her works unveil the truths, power, beauty, and vulnerabilities of women in particular. Kim Frohsin’s paintings, drawings, and monotypes, are highly sought worldwide and are found in numerous consequential public and private art collections.
Kim Frohsin original figure painting 'Green Interior Nude' was created in 2006. It is signed front and verso and unframed at 10 1/2 x 7 1/2 inches. Proudly presented by Andra Norris Gallery in California.

Kim Frohsin
Kim Frohsin, Third generation Bay Area Figurative artist is at home with a variety of media, including painting, drawing, monoprints, mixed media and collage. Her subjects include the female figure, cityscape, iconic Coke-Work, Portraits of Numbers, and other objects that attract her attention and which are most often autobiographical in nature. Frohsin began exhibiting in the San Francisco Bay Area in the early 1990s, and in 1993 was included with Nathan Olivera, Manuel Neri and Stephen De Staebler in an exhibit of 'Four Figures from the Bay.' With Wayne Thiebaud as the juror, she won the California Society of Printmakers' Award in 1996, and the following year exhibited at the de Young Museum in San Francisco in "Bay Area Art: The Morgan Flagg Collection. " Born: 1961, Atlanta, GA Moved to California: 1979

Jack Hooper
"Green Nude 2"
c. 1980s
Acrylic paint on magazine page
9"x11.5", black wood gallery frame float mount 11"x14"
Signed in pencil lower right
Hooper's distinctive approach to artistry is exemplified by his ingenious use of acrylic paint on a magazine page, where elements of the original page subtly peek through the layers of vibrant color. This technique adds an intriguing depth to the composition, blurring the boundaries between reality and abstraction.
Jack Meredith Hooper (August 26, 1928 - January 24, 2014) was an American painter, muralist, sculptor, printmaker and art educator. Hooper was a major figure on the Southern California art scene, belonging to that generation of Los Angeles painters...
